# Formula Sandbox: Limits and Quotas

User-supplied formulas in Gristlevane run inside an isolated evaluator with strict resource ceilings. Each evaluation gets its own memory arena, a bounded instruction budget, and no I/O. When a limit trips, the cell renders an error and the event is logged to the `sandbox.violations` stream — check there first during an incident before suspecting the scheduler. Quotas apply per tenant, per minute, and are enforced before evaluation begins. The current enforcement constants are as follows.

tuning constants:
QUOTAS = {
    "druwyn": 5,
    "holix": 5,
    "zorath": 5,
    "holwyn": 10,
}

## Releases

Heads up, plugin folks: starting with Quillforge 3.2, config changes hot-reload without a restart. Your plugin just needs to implement the `onConfigSwap` hook and you'll get the fresh settings handed to you. No hook? You keep the old values until the next full restart, which is fine but boring. Release tarballs are published every other Thursday. Before loading any plugin bundle, Quillforge verifies it against the publisher key shown here.

deploy key for kajof-fajop: bky6_gDHw9Q

**Ticket: FEEDVAL-218 — intermittent connection failures**

The Wrenfield podcast feed validator has been dropping connections to its results store roughly every six hours since the last deploy. Retries eventually succeed, so validation runs complete, but latency alerts keep firing. Suspect the pool is exhausting idle slots during the hourly bulk revalidation. For anyone picking this up later: reproduce by running the validator locally against the shared store, using the string below.

replica DSN, kajep-yahag: mssql://praok_svc:iF@db-8d68.plorvaio.local:5432/eliion

Subject: Welcome to Hayrig on-call

Hi — glad to have you on the rotation. Hayrig is our telemetry gateway for tractor fleets; most pages are just field units dropping offline after storms, nothing scary. Ack within ten minutes, check the gateway queue first. Everything you need, including the escalation ladder, is on the internal page here.

runbook for badug-kadup: https://confluence.zemvarlabs.internal/projects/browse/display/projects/bd1b